A few numbers worth knowing if you have a hearing in front of Judge Miller, Jane Chace. (IJ code JCM, Indianapolis, IN):
Overall track record
7 years on the bench (since 2020), 1,429 cases total, lifetime grant rate 0.3%
Last 3 years (2023–2026): 1,416 cases, grant rate 0.3% — 7.6pp below the Indianapolis court average (8.0%)
Nationality breakdown (2023–2026 cumulative)
Nationality / Cases / Grant rate Honduras 219 0.0% Mexico 217 0.0% Nicaragua 199 0.0% Venezuela 174 0.0% Guatemala 152 0.0% El Salvador 96 0.0% India 64 0.0% Colombia 61 0.0% Haiti 55 0.0% Cuba 41 14.3% Ecuador 36 0.0%
Year-by-year
2023: 5 cases, 0.0% grant rate 2024: 404 cases, 0.5% grant rate 2025: 364 cases, 0.0% grant rate 2026: 643 cases, 0.4% grant rate
